Weather in Newcastle, New South Wales, Australia in August

In an average August, Newcastle sees a daily high around 17°C and a low around 12°C, based on 1981–2026 of local climate records.

Average high17°C
Typical high range15°C to 20°C
Average low12°C
Typical low range10°C to 14°C
Average daily precipitation3 mm

August records

The most extreme August on record for each metric, across 1981–2026. For rainfall, the wettest and driest are by total August accumulation.

High

Highest 25°C 1995-08-21
Lowest 12°C 2001-08-27

Low

Highest 19°C 2009-08-24
Lowest 7°C 2015-08-05

Feels-like

Highest 25°C 1995-08-21
Lowest 3°C 1986-08-06

Humidity

Highest 14.2 g/m³ 2003-08-13
Lowest 5.9 g/m³ 2005-08-11

Wind

Highest 45 km/h 1996-08-19
Lowest 6 km/h 1987-08-15

Precip

Wettest 222 mm 1998
Driest 3 mm 1995
